Subject : Maclaren triumph or techno xt

Hi - advice please!!
I'm looking to buy a stroller for my LO. We have the M&p ultima which is lovely for newborns + young babies but really heavy with my little lump in it! I've been looking at Maclaren triumph & techno xt - is it worth paying the extra for the xt or is triumph ok?
Thanks in advance!!Confused

Hello,i would say it's def worth paying the xtra for the xt-it is a fantastic pushchair which has great suspension for child of all ages and depending on how u get on with parasol's it's got a built in sunshade so covers little one from the sun,it is also quite light and is easy to recline-the triumph is a pig to recline. The xt is also suitable from birth if looking to have anymore in future.hope this helps xx

Go for the techno. We have a triumph for holidays and although it does the job, if I had to use it more it would annoy me. Like Clare says the suspension makes the techno much easier to push. The seat on the Techno goes up straighter as well which is a big plus if your lo is as nosey as mine!
